Manchester United made the trip to The Goldsands Stadium on Saturday and were welcomed by their league rivals AFC Bournemouth in their clash in the Premier League, after the hosts who had managed to pull off a shocking win over the champions of England, Chelsea in their previous game at Stamford Bridge. After being knocked out of the Champions League due to their loss to Wolfsburg, the Red Devils would want to improve on that form this time around. Things have not been looking too great for the Manchester based side, who were dropping points in recent weeks and were fading away from their title challenge though Van Gaal had been keen on winning silverware this season.
Louis van Gaal’s side once again did not look confident and started off poorly and lost a goal in the 2nd minute of the game, as Stanislas scored for the hosts. However, the Dutchman’s side equalized on the 24th minute, as Marouane Fellaini put one in. There were no more goals in the first half, as the two sides went into the break at 1-1.
After the break, the home side looked more positive once again and took the lead in the 54th minute when King added a second goal for his team and the game ended in a 2-1 win to Bournemouth, with Van Gaal frustrated once again.
